Default CDRW_With Alert

This indicator is based on volume and price (H, L, C).It is similar to Market Facilitation Index (BWMFI_Main_Window) which Enivid created for MT5 and MT4. CDRW is much better because it takes in aaccount closing price which is significnt difference and has alert on each of 4 signals...Hope Enivid will find a little time to convert it to MT5 version...I have this indicator all the time on chart. I forgot to say that indicator CDRW was created by "thatwasme" from another website and another forum...Here is description/interpretation of signals by"thatwasme":

This is a indicator I wrote for myself.

It has 4 states.
I believe that a price volume bar can have one of 4 states.

1. It can have increasing spread and decreasing volume. This means that price is moving without strong participation and can not be sustained. Due to the lack of participation, the price is ripe for a reversal.
This is displayed as a Magenta Diamond on that bar.

2. It can have increasing spread and increasing volume. This means there is wide participation and price should continue in this direction.
A red arrow shows the direction down when supply is overtaking demand.
A blue arrow shows direction up when demand is overtaking supply.

3. It can have decreasing spread and increasing volume, which means that the supply and the demand are temporarily stalemated. This is a warning that the direction move may be losing steam.
This is shown by a yellow x on that bar.

4. It can have decreasing spread and decreasing volume. This to me means that the bar has little participation from anyone and that the market is dull or congested. I do not show any indicator for this, because it does not portend any information other than dullness.

If you can use it feel free to do so. This is from my own style of volume trading and not strictly VSA per say.
